The use of The Chain as the theme music for this programme is the reason why I'm an FM fan. For years I always wanted to know who recorded that piece of music. I eventually found out that it was FM in 1987 when a school friend lent me a tape with Rumours and Tango on. That tape got me hooked on FM, which resulted in the purchase of every CD they've done, a lot of the solo CD's, seeing them 6 times live, buying a few t-shirts and even a cell from an animation on E-bay! He's in his teens... he hasn't really had a chance to "find" early Mac yet. It took me a while, too, when I was at that age, to have the financial resources to start investigating pre-Buckingham & Nicks FM. I knew "Oh Well" from 'Fleetwood Mac Live' and from a radio show I taped, which featured British bands and their most famous songs, but that was about all I knew of the original Mac for a long time. Hopefully the "youngins'" will realize that Fleetwood Mac's rich history is most definitely worth looking into, and that their best music doesn't necessarily begin and end with Lindsey & Stevie. :nod: :) |
